Output 3e3fd59baaa87388349294a259c60e8c27a9bd9a36859c8ff3091a9515c85607:0

value
351263958
script pubkey
OP_0 OP_PUSHBYTES_20 8db654ebd2c551a99c4c3e167aac35b264d7d2b7
address
bc1q3km9f67jc4g6n8zv8ct84tp4kfjd054hsmc9vn
transaction
3e3fd59baaa87388349294a259c60e8c27a9bd9a36859c8ff3091a9515c85607